Inspired by Gamay from both France and Oregon, the Twelve Oaks Estate Gamay Noir is made in the traditional manner, utilizing both carbonic and extended maceration. This results in an age worthy wine brimming with ripe, dark berry flavors, lithe tannin and lively acidity. Grapes were hand-picked and brought directly to the winery in 1/2-ton totes. They were hand sorted on a shaker table into 2-ton open top, stainless steel fermenters, which were then sealed with a stainless-steel lid. The must was cold-soaked for five days without oxygen contact, which was followed by fermentation that was completed in about a week. This is followed by an extended maceration without oxygen contact, where the wine is evaluated daily for softening of tannins and roundness of palate. After draining the fermenters by gravity, the free-run and light pressings were combined and settled for 48 hours. The wine was then racked by gravity into used French oak barrels. The wine was aged on lees in French oak barrels for 10 months until bottled. Aroma: blackberries, black tea, potting soil, tobacco, violets, saddle leather. Flavor: ripe raspberry, fruit leather, sassafras, blueberries. Finish: long, acid driven, with beautiful rusticity. 100% Gamay Noir
